Climate Litigation and Vulnerabilities: Global South Perspectives - Routledge Studies in Law, Rights and Justice
Climate Litigation and Vulnerabilities: Global South Perspectives - Routledge Studies in Law, Rights and Justice
This volume explores climate litigation as a means to tackle the rights and socio-ecological, intergenerational, gender, racial, and other justice implications of ever-growing vulnerability to climate change, whilst critically engaging with the notions of vulnerability and intersectional climate justice.
